**Q: How do I access the shared lab we use with the Quillhaven Optics team?** The lab on Level 3 of the Ferncastle Building is jointly managed, so access requests must be approved by both team leads before the facilities desk updates your badge profile. Until your badge is provisioned, which can take two working days, you may enter using the temporary door code shown here.

door code, yagap-bahof: bdg-O-05

## 2.8.1 — Key Rotation

Rotated the signing key used by the Lattermill circuit breaker that guards the upstream Fenwick Rates API. Old key is revoked effective this release; breaker config bundles signed with it will fail validation. Support should re-issue any cached configs. For verification during the transition window, the new key follows.

rollout seal: bky19_M1Zvn1YQwEBTy4XxP3H

## Build Provenance: CalMesh Sync Conflict

Heads up — the Tuesday CalMesh release picked up a stale calendar-sync fixture because two pipelines fired from overlapping cron windows. Provenance for the shipped artifact is intact, but double-check which run actually produced it before signing off. The winning build's token is below.

pipeline stamp: htk3_69f